wiper system commutator

The wiper system commutator is a crucial component in modern automotive wiper systems, serving as the electrical interface between the stationary and rotating parts of the wiper motor. This essential device consists of copper segments separated by insulating material, working in conjunction with carbon brushes to transfer electrical power and control signals. The commutator enables smooth and consistent operation of the wiper system by managing the electrical current distribution that drives the motor's rotation. Its sophisticated design incorporates multiple contact points to ensure reliable performance across various weather conditions and operating speeds. The component is engineered with high-grade materials to withstand continuous use, temperature variations, and environmental exposure. In modern vehicles, the wiper system commutator integrates seamlessly with electronic control modules to provide variable speed control and intermittent wiper functions. The precision manufacturing process ensures optimal contact surface area and minimal electrical resistance, contributing to the system's overall efficiency and longevity. This component is fundamental in maintaining clear visibility during adverse weather conditions, making it an indispensable part of vehicle safety systems.

Advanced Durability and Reliability

Advanced Durability and Reliability

The wiper system commutator's exceptional durability stems from its advanced manufacturing process and material selection. The component utilizes high-grade copper alloys specifically chosen for their excellent conductivity and wear resistance properties. The segmented design incorporates precision-engineered gaps filled with high-performance insulating materials that maintain their integrity even under extreme conditions. This construction ensures consistent electrical contact while minimizing friction and wear, resulting in an extended service life that often matches the vehicle's lifespan. The component undergoes rigorous quality control processes, including thermal cycling tests and endurance evaluations, to verify its long-term reliability. The surface treatment of the copper segments includes special coatings that prevent oxidation and maintain optimal electrical conductivity throughout the component's life cycle.
